If you prefer to buy car insurance from a local agent, it’s helpful to know the different agency structures and how they operate. Car insurance agents in Phoenix are either independent agents or exclusive agents depending on their employer. Both can write car insurance policies, but it’s worth learning how they are different since it can affect which agent you choose.

Exclusive Insurance Agents

These agents can only provide pricing for a single company and examples are AAA, State Farm, Farmers Insurance, and Allstate. They generally cannot compare rates from other companies so it’s a take it or leave it situation. Exclusive agents receive extensive training on what they offer which helps them sell insurance even at higher premiums.

Independent Agents (or Brokers)

Agents of this type often have many company appointments so they have the ability to put coverage with many different companies and help determine which has the cheapest rates. If premiums increase, the business is moved internally which makes it simple for you.

When comparing car insurance rates, you should always get quotes from multiple independent agents to get the most accurate price comparison.

Auto insurance coverages explained

Learning about specific coverages of your policy can help you determine which coverages you need and proper limits and deductibles. Auto insurance terms can be ambiguous and nobody wants to actually read their policy.

Collision protection

This covers damage to your Niro resulting from a collision with another car or object. You will need to pay your deductible then the remaining damage will be paid by your insurance company.

Collision coverage protects against things such as sustaining damage from a pot hole, hitting a mailbox, colliding with a tree, driving through your garage door and scraping a guard rail. Collision coverage makes up a good portion of your premium, so consider removing coverage from older vehicles. Another option is to increase the deductible on your Niro to bring the cost down.

Medical costs insurance

Med pay and PIP coverage kick in for short-term medical expenses for things like funeral costs, surgery and ambulance fees. The coverages can be used in conjunction with a health insurance policy or if there is no health insurance coverage. They cover all vehicle occupants and will also cover if you are hit as a while walking down the street. Personal injury protection coverage is not an option in every state and may carry a deductible

Liability insurance

This coverage can cover damage that occurs to a person or their property in an accident. Coverage consists of three different limits, bodily injury for each person, bodily injury for the entire accident, and a limit for property damage. You commonly see liability limits of 15/30/10 which stand for $15,000 bodily injury coverage, a total of $30,000 of bodily injury coverage per accident, and $10,000 of coverage for damaged property.

Liability insurance covers claims such as repair costs for stationary objects, emergency aid and court costs. How much liability should you purchase? That is a personal decision, but consider buying as large an amount as possible. Arizona requires drivers to carry at least 15/30/10 but drivers should carry more liability than the minimum.

UM/UIM Coverage

Uninsured or Underinsured Motorist coverage provides protection from other drivers when they are uninsured or don’t have enough coverage. This coverage pays for medical payments for you and your occupants as well as your vehicle’s damage.

Since many Arizona drivers have only the minimum liability required by law (which is 15/30/10), their liability coverage can quickly be exhausted. That’s why carrying high Uninsured/Underinsured Motorist coverage is a good idea.

Comprehensive or Other Than Collision

This covers damage OTHER than collision with another vehicle or object. A deductible will apply and the remainder of the damage will be paid by comprehensive coverage.

Comprehensive insurance covers things like falling objects, vandalism and damage from a tornado or hurricane. The highest amount you can receive from a comprehensive claim is the market value of your vehicle, so if your deductible is as high as the vehicle’s value consider removing comprehensive coverage.
